What happens when a stationary front passes?

Answers

Answer:

_________

Explanation:

Because a stationary front marks the boundary between two air masses, there are often differences in air temperature and wind on opposite sides of it. The weather is often cloudy along a stationary front, and rain or snow often falls, especially if the front is in an area of low atmospheric pressure.

Which of the following is true regarding glycolysis ?
Choose 1 answer.
A.) It requires glucose as a reactant.
B.) It produces 36 ATP.
C.) It occurs in the mitochondria.
D.) It is an aerobic process. ​

Answers

Answer:

I would have to say A

Explanation:

Glycolysis is the first step in the breakdown of glucose to extract energy for cellular metabolism. So we already know that it uses glucose because thats what its breaking down. Glycosis produces 2 ATP so B is wrong. Glycolysis happens in the cytoplasm so C is wrong. Finnaly aerobic is using free oxygen in the process of the reaction. However glycolysis uses no oxygen and is  anaerobic.

Glycolysis requires glucose as a reactant.  

Glycolysis refers to a cytoplasmic pathway that dissociates glucose into the three-carbon compound and produces energy in the form of ATP.  

• The process of glycolysis takes place in the cytoplasm.  

• In the process, the net production of 2 ATPs takes place.  

• It can be both anaerobic and aerobic process.  

• The process of glycolysis completes in 10 steps, five of which are in the preparatory phase and the rest 5 are in the pay-off phase.  

• The process of glycolysis is used by all the cells of the body to produce energy, and the final product of glycolysis is pyruvate.  

Thus, correct answer is option A, that is, it requires glucose as a reactant.

Products enter a reaction and reactants come out of a reaction true or false?

Answers

Answer:

[tex]\boxed {\boxed {\sf False }}[/tex]

Explanation:

In a chemical reaction, the products are produced. The reactants are the substances that react.

In a chemical reaction equation (with the arrow pointing right) the reactants are on the left and the products on the right.

[tex]reactants \rightarrow products[/tex]

The reactants enter and the products come out.

So, the statement given - products enter a reaction and reactants come out - is false and it is actually the other way around.

What are angiosperms?

Angiosperms, that are also known as flowering plants, have “seeds” that are sealed off within an “ovary”, while gymnosperms do not have fruits or flowers and have uncovered seeds on the surface of leaves. Seeds of gymnosperms are often arranged as “cones”.

The features and characteristics that distinguish angiosperms from gymnosperms are fruits, flowers, and “endosperm” in the seeds. Examples of “Angiosperms” are “monocots” like orchids, lilies, agaves, grasses and dicots like, peas, roses, sunflowers, maples and oaks. “Gymnosperm” examples include “non-flowering evergreen” trees like pine, fir and spruce.

What is a hydrogen bond?

Answers

Hydrogen bonding, interaction of a hydrogen atom located between a pair of other atoms having a high affinity for electrons; such a bond is weaker than an ionic bond or covalent bond but stronger than van der Waals forces

Answer:

A hydrogen bond is a weak bond between two molecules resulting from an electrostatic attraction between a proton in one molecule and an electronegative atom in the other.

Which point shows the prevailing westerlies?
O1
O 2
O3
O4

Answers

Answer:

1

Explanation:

Prevailing Westerlies are the winds in the middle latitudes between 35 and 65 degrees latitude. They tend to blow from the high pressure area in the horse latitudes towards the poles. These prevailing winds blow from the west to the east steering extra-tropical cyclones in this general manner.
